Transaction 37962c88a30cb9c66f2fe3efeafe31fc3a3b1b6694bb4cf3c65c8ca484f01284
1 Input
1 Output
-
37962c88a30cb9c66f2fe3efeafe31fc3a3b1b6694bb4cf3c65c8ca484f01284:0
- value
- 128203612
- script pubkey
- OP_0 OP_PUSHBYTES_20 0bed8c981d2fa92b636223ed717765f287f91a90
- address
- bc1qp0kcexqa975jkcmzy0khzam972rljx5s2f2yrt